一流学科助力土木工程人才跨越式发展培养模式探索

摘  要:依托土木工程一流学科,提出“重基础、强能力、突创新”的培养理念,注重基础课程改革,拓宽研究生国际化视野,提升科研成果质量,结合一流学科,探索土木工程人才跨越式发展的培养模式,重点解决土木工程专业研究生教育所面临的高水平科研论文数量较少、国际化视野拓宽力度不足、特色留学生培养模式缺乏的问题。实践证明“重基础、强能力、突创新”的培养理念与模式可显著提升土木工程专业研究生培养质量与科研创新能力,为西部高校土木工程创新型人才培养提供借鉴经验。Relying on the first-class discipline of civil engineering,the cultivation concept of"emphasizing foundation,strengthening abilities,and highlighting innovation"was proposed,and the cultivation mode for the leapfrog development of civil engineering talents was explored by reforming basic courses,expanding the international perspective of graduate students,improving the quality of scientific research results and combining with first-class disciplines.The main problems during the graduate education in civil engineering were solved,such as a small number of high-level scientific research papers,insufficient efforts to broaden international perspectives,and a lack of distinctive training modes for international students.It has been proven from practice that the cultivation concept and mode of"emphasizing foundation,strengthening ability,and sudden innovation"have significantly improved the quality and scientific research innovation ability of civil engineering graduate students,providing reference experience for the cultivation of innovative civil engineering talents in western universities.
